Journal: :Physical review letters 2003
Ernesto F Galvão Lucien Hardy

We show that a qubit can be used to substitute for a classical analog system requiring an arbitrarily large number of classical bits to represent digitally. Let a physical system S interact locally with a classical field varphi(x) as S travels directly from point A to point B. Our task is to use S to answer a simple yes/no question about varphi(x). Many philosophers endorse deterrence justifications of legal punishment. According to these justifications, punishment is justified at least in part because it deters offenses. These justifications rely on empirical assumptions, e.g., that non-punitive enforcement can’t deter or that it can’t deter enough.
